Rubens: Acknowledging Dinamos Legacy Demands a Push for the Top of the Table

Midfielder of Moscow’s Dynamo, Rubens, commented on the team’s performance in the first half of the 2025/2026 season.

«The start has been rocky and difficult for Dynamo. We need to turn things around as quickly as possible. We recognize how prestigious Dynamo is as a club and that we should consistently be competing for the upper spots in the standings, rather than where we currently are. It’s essential to keep working hard to improve our situation,» Rubens shared in an interview with Championship correspondent Maria Kutsubaeva.

Dynamo is currently in 10th place in the Russian league table, having earned 17 points from 15 matches. The team, coached by Valery Karpin, is trailing leaders Krasnodar by 16 points.
